Output 43ee771b0084f5a17a934221fc5aa0a2d253626df007b9ffea70b723326bd90a:12

value
13555275
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ca60f96693e693a9d64332aa5f93032519069200 OP_EQUAL
address
3L96bBRZ19JW9qmtSbauTCpML1iHTy9Uj8
transaction
43ee771b0084f5a17a934221fc5aa0a2d253626df007b9ffea70b723326bd90a
spent
true